Superserver 1028R-WC1RT beeps when touched with hand. by krisen in supermicro

[–]krisen[S] 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I grounded myself to it's chassis via an esd bracelet before trying what seen in the video. It stops it from beeping every time. So it's super sensitive to esd as it seems. I have worked with supermicro servers for 15 years and never seen this behavior before.

Installation reboots around 20% of base system installation by barcef in freebsd

[–]krisen 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I had similar issue on similar older supermicro hardware installing freenas. Turn off watchdog via jumper on motherboard.
